The battery industry is undergoing rapid transformation, driven by the increasing demand for efficient energy storage solutions to support the integration of renewable energy sources and enhance grid stability. Vanadium pentoxide (V2O5) has emerged as a key player in this revolution, particularly in the development of vanadium-based energy storage systems like vanadium redox flow batteries (VRFBs). This article explores the characteristics and applications of vanadium pentoxide in the battery industry and its contribution to advancing energy storage technologies.

Grid-Scale Energy Storage: VRFBs using vanadium pentoxide are employed for grid-scale energy storage, allowing utility companies to store excess energy during periods of low demand and release it during peak periods.

Renewable Energy Integration: VRFBs play a vital role in integrating renewable energy sources, such as solar and wind, into the grid. They store surplus renewable energy for use when generation is insufficient.

Load-Leveling and Frequency Regulation: VRFBs using vanadium pentoxide provide load-leveling services, managing fluctuations in electricity demand and frequency regulation, stabilizing the grid.

Remote and Off-Grid Applications: VRFBs are used in remote and off-grid locations to provide stable and reliable power where access to the grid is limited.

Industrial and Commercial Energy Storage: VRFBs using vanadium pentoxide find applications in industries and commercial facilities to offset energy costs, reduce peak demand charges, and enhance grid resilience.
